Understanding Commercial Loan Structures and Interest Rates
Securing the appropriate commercial loan can be a pivotal factor for businesses aiming to expand operations or navigate financial hurdles. Exploring into the intricacies of loan structures and interest rates is crucial for making an informed selection that aligns your company's long-term goals.
A commercial loan structure defines the terms and conditions governing the disbursement of funds, including the repayment schedule, collateral requirements, and potential fees. Standard structures encompass term loans, lines of credit, and SBA loans, each offering unique perks.
Interest rates, on the other hand, determine the price of borrowing capital. They are often expressed as an annual percentage rate (APR) and fluctuate based on factors such as your company's creditworthiness, economic conditions, and the prevailing interest rate setting.
Meticulous research and comparison shopping are essential to locate a loan structure and interest rate that maximizes your financial position.
Acquiring a Commercial Mortgage Application Process
Navigating the intricate world of commercial mortgage applications can feel overwhelming. It's a multifaceted process that demands careful preparation. Firstly,, you need to gather all the necessary financial documents, including tax returns, income statements, and debt schedules.
Next, select a experienced lender who specializes in commercial mortgages. Evaluate different lenders to find one that offers competitive interest rates, flexible loan terms, and tailored service. Once you've selected a lender, they will guide you through the request process, which often encompasses an underwriter reviewing your {financialcreditworthiness and asset details.
Across this entire process, it's important to be organized. Keep track of all deadlines, interact promptly with your lender, and be prepared to answer any inquires they may have.
